Purpose
Synopsis
int XPRBfixvar(XPRBvar var, double val);
Arguments
var
|
BCL reference to a variable.
|
val
|
The value to which the variable is to be fixed.
|
Return value
0 if function executed successfully, 1 otherwise.
Example
The following code sets the value of variable x1 to 20.
XPRBprob prob;
XPRBvar x1;
...
x1 = XPRBnewvar(prob, XPRB_UI, "abc3", 1, 100);
XPRBfixvar(x1, 20.0);
Further information
This function fixes a variable to the given value.
It replaces calls to
XPRBsetub and
XPRBsetlb. The
value
val may lie outside the original bounds of the variable.
Related topics
If you have any comments or suggestions about these pages,
please send mail to docs@dashoptimization.com.